La Voz Maya de México: A Cultural Beacon in Bécal, Campeche
La Voz Maya de México - 1470 AM - XEBAL-AM is a prominent local radio station broadcasting from Bécal, Campeche, Mexico. Known for its social concession, this station is dedicated to serving the community with a rich array of programming that encompasses local music, news, and cultural content. As a vital source of information and entertainment, La Voz Maya plays an essential role in connecting the residents of Bécal and the surrounding areas to their cultural roots and current events.
Celebrating Local Music and Culture
At the heart of La Voz Maya de México’s programming is its commitment to local music. The station serves as a platform for promoting the vibrant sounds of Campeche and the broader Mayan culture, ensuring that local artists and musicians receive the recognition they deserve. By playing a diverse range of Spanish-language music, the station resonates with listeners who appreciate both traditional and contemporary sounds, fostering a strong sense of community identity.
Informative and Engaging Content
In addition to its musical offerings, La Voz Maya de México is dedicated to delivering local news and cultural programming that reflects the interests and needs of its audience. The station provides timely updates on community events, social issues, and cultural celebrations, making it a trusted source of information for residents. This focus on local news ensures that listeners stay informed about matters that affect their daily lives, fostering a sense of involvement and empowerment within the community.
Sports Coverage
La Voz Maya de México also caters to sports enthusiasts by broadcasting baseball programs from the Liga Calkiní. This inclusion of sports programming not only entertains listeners but also strengthens community ties as local teams and athletes gain exposure. By covering events that matter to the community, the station creates a shared experience that unites fans and promotes local pride.
